05/17/2017 02:00 | 05/17/2017 10:45 | Internet2 WAN connectivity | Intermittent WAN connectivity. The outage was a result of Tech Services' DWDM system, which provides us with our physical optical path up to Chicago via the ICCN. Specifically, the Adva card that our 100G wave is on was seeing strange errors, which was causing input framing errors for traffic coming in on this interface. | General WAN connectivity to XSEDE sites, certain commodity routes, and other I2 AL2S connections. | The Adva card was rebooted and we stopped seeing the input framing errors. Tech Services is working with Adva to find the root cause of the issues on the card. |
